SUPPLEMENTAL INFORMATION

RECORD KEEPING

  • Commercial pesticide applicators are required to maintain records of restricted use pesticide applications for 3 years (Regulation 636, Rule 15(1))
  • Private applicators do not have a record keeping requirement in State of Michigan law
    • However, USDA requires that records of restricted use pesticides must be recorded no later than 14 days following a federally restricted use pesticide application and must be maintained for 2 years following the application in accordance with the 1990 Farm Bill
  • All other record keeping requirements on the label must be followed
